Optimizing PowerPoint Tables for IoT Sales Team
As an IoT sales team, optimizing PowerPoint tables for your investor communication during quarterly earnings calls is a crucial aspect of presenting your data clearly and effectively.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to do so:
1. Simplify Your Information
Firstly, try to simplify the data you’re presenting as much as possible. Investors may not be tech-savvy or familiar with IoT jargon. So, avoid using complex terms and ensure your tables present the data in a straightforward, digestible manner. Aim to convey the most critical information and avoid overwhelming your audience with too many details.
2. Use Clear, Concise Labels
Ensure that all your tables have clear and concise labels. It’s essential to make it easy for the audience to understand what the data represents, especially when dealing with financial information. Be consistent with your labeling throughout your presentation.
3. Highlight Key Data
Highlight key data points that you want your audience to focus on. You can do this using different colors, bolding the text, or adding an icon next to the data point. This can help draw the audience’s attention to the most important parts of your table.
4. Use Easy-to-Read Fonts
Ensure that the fonts you use in your tables are easy to read. Avoid fonts that are overly stylized or difficult to read at a quick glance. Opt for clear, simple fonts and ensure the text size is large enough to be read comfortably.
5. Incorporate Visual Elements
Consider using graphs or charts to supplement your tables. Visual elements can be a powerful way to convey information and can often be easier to understand than raw data. If your data lends itself to being represented visually, this can be an effective way to communicate your message.
6. Consistency Is Key
Ensure that the design and layout of your tables are consistent throughout your presentation. This includes the color scheme, font style, and size. Consistency helps reinforce your brand identity and makes your presentation look more professional.
By following these steps, you can optimize your PowerPoint tables to effectively communicate your quarterly earnings to investors. Remember, your ultimate goal is to make your data as clear and understandable as possible to facilitate better investor communication.
